Enterprise Rent-A-Car is adding approximately 5,000 additional gas/electric hybrids to its nationwide fleet and designating nearly 80 rental locations across the country as “hybrid branches.” The new hybrids will be available in 24 major markets across the country, including the 10 busiest airports for business travelers in the United States.

HAVs deployed in shared-use fleets can operate continuously and don’t require parking, making them ideal for areas where parking is scarce. Additionally, high-trip concentration increases the opportunity for ride-sharing by pairing users traveling along the same route, while minimizing passenger-less travel. INRIX HAV City Score.
